Maybe my friends and I got the wrong food, but there wasn't anything stellar about the food. It just tasted like well cooked food, but did not justify the fairly high price points. Complimentary bread - I would have been fine with the bread if it was just warmed up. It was a bit tough to chew. Saghanaki - A fairly strong tasting cheese. Not particularly for me. Calamari - Standard affair of fried calamari. Crispy and delicious. Fried Smelts - Oddly enough, I wished these tasted a bit fishier. Maybe I am too used to the ones from takeout places. Grilled Octopus - While this was delicious, the octopus had a texture that felt slightly powdery and too tender. Sea Bream - It was just okay. The flesh was tender and moist but it was lacking flavor. It could have used extra dressing. The braised greens that came along with the dish were an afterthought. It felt like it was just boiled and dropped onto the plate.

Great greek restaurant downtown Melo Park with 2 parking lots on the street in addition to street parking. There were no reservations available online for the time I was going to be in the area. When I called the gentleman who answered told me to come over and they would probably be able to accommodate me and they did! So glad I got to try it. I had saganaki, my favorite, grilled prawns and roasted branzino (Mediterranean sea bass) my other favorite. The is no cocktail menu but they have a full bar and can make almost anything. For desert, I ordered the cheese cake desert special to go. I think the crust was a crunchy roasted coconut crust and it was topped with strawberry rhubarb reduction drizzle. It was very good the next day for breakfast- hope it gets added to the regular menu. I get why it is ranked so well on TA and highly recommend a visit during your stay in the area.

Very good food and service, felt a little rushed, a bit pricey
We went for our anniversary dinner and really enjoyed the food. We shared two appetizers, one excellent and the other fine but a little small. I had a whole fish dish and my wife had a lamb dish. I found my fish very good but wasn't thrilled with the accompanying vegetable (but I'm not a fan of spinach), she found hers excellent. We also had two desserts, both very good. Service was friendly and despite a full house very quick, but I did feel a little rushed. Price point was a little high but apps, drinks and dessert were in line with other restaurants, only entrees ran high. We were offered our choice of indoor or outdoor seating, but as the indoors was pretty packed we opted for outdoor. Although this was street tent seating they did a very nice job of making it feel very welcoming including lighted plants and trees, etc. It didn't feel 2nd class.
